Well we need to check your nerd cred, so here's a fun problem.

You've been hired by an amusement park to build their new zipline ride. The stated requirement is that it be the zipline with the largest drop in the world (height at least N), and it needs to connect across a natural canyon at the park of width M, but further that to get as many customers on it as possible, it must be the shortest possible ride time.

If we start with the assumption of essentially no friction, and that you will make the height exactly N and the width will be just enough to get across the canyon - what length is the cable that will provide the shortest travel time, and describe the shape.

Next if we unpin the ends and allow for any height greater than or equal to N, and any width greater than or equal to M, does there exist a choice of height and width that will provide a shorter travel time than exactly N,M; prove your result either way.
